Doncaster (DN22)
The DN22 postcode area is located in the Doncaster postcode town region, within the county of Nottinghamshire, and contains a total of 1446 individual postcodes.
There are 66 electoral wards in the DN22 postcode area, including Barnetby, Barrow-Upon-Humber, Barton-Upon-Humber, Brigg, Cleethorpes, Doncaster, Gainsborough, Goole, Grimsby, Immingham, Retford, Scunthorpe, Ulceby which come under the local authority of the Bassetlaw Council.
Combining the whole postcode region, 19% of people in DN22 are classed as having an AB social grade, (i.e. 'white-collar' middle-upper class), compared to 27% across the UK.
This does not mean that the people of DN22 are poorer than other areas, but it may give an indication that there are areas of deprivation.
DN22 postcode is in the Doncaster district of South Yorkshire in the United Kingdom. It covers the easternmost part of the town of Retford and parts of the hamlets of East Retford, West Retford, Amcotts, Bole and Sutton-cum-Lound. The postcode area is predominantly rural in nature with only a small number of populated settlements. Most of the settlements are located close to the River Idle.
The postcode area covers 6404 hectares of mostly predominately rural landscape. The majority of the dwellings are detached and semi-detached houses and bungalows, although there is a small number of terraced houses and flats. The region is well-connected by road and public transport. The major roads include the A1 which provides a direct link to other parts of the country, while the Lincolnshire border is accessible from the A57. In addition, the East Coast mainline provides connection to London Kings Cross in under two hours.

Nottinghamshire
DN22 is located in the county of Nottinghamshire, in England.
Nottinghamshire has a total population of 1,136,000, making it the 15th largest county in the UK.
Nottinghamshire has a total area of 834 square miles, and a population density of 526 people per square kilometre. For comparison, Greater London has a density of 5,618 people/km2.
